‘Jersey Shore’ creator: house is like a ‘herpes nest’


In a roundtable discussion about the production of reality shows, Jersey Shore creator SallyAnn Salsano, herself a native of Jersey Shore twin Long Island, called the set of the show a “herpes nest” and admitted to dispensing the herpes medication Valtrex “like M&Ms.”

Salsano didn’t confirm whether any of the show’s “stars” are infected, but said:

Salsano: I do a full medical but I also do a lot of STD stuff.

(Dr. Drew) Pinsky: The network requires me to do stuff with my patients that has no relevance to anything. Like everyone on the set has to take (herpes medication) Valtrex.

Salsano: We hand it out like M&Ms! “Hey kids, it’s time for Valtrex!” It’s like a herpes nest. They’re all in there mixing it up.

Salsano did say that she “cares” about all the participants on the show, and even said she has Snooki’s parents’ numbers in her cell phone. The reality show creator also struck out at people who critique the “low culture” aspects of the MTV hit:

Salsano: I got a lot of heat when “Jersey Shore” came out. All the papers were pissy. But you know what? You can be as mad as you want. I was raised on Long Island, my dad is a sanitation worker, he drives a triple black Cadillac. Right now he’s sitting in his recliner chair with a Yankees symbol. Those are my people! So they’re like, “You’re being a racist.” I’m like, “F*** you guys, this is my life. I went to the Jersey shore. You know, I was Snooki. I made a ton of mistakes and got my ass kicked in a bar.” It is what it is.
